An oldy but still impressive.  Project spotlight relied on a proxy vehicle covered in tracking markers called the Blackbird, which was developed by visual effects studio The Mill.
An early example of unreal engine pushing the boundaries into VFX production.  The benefits being to film a car commercial without the actual final car in the frame, ‘The Human Race’ was also imagined as an augmented reality experience where users could change vehicle characteristics themselves (such as the make or colour).
This was a high profile convergence of skills and industries (game engines and VFX) which will only benefit the production pipeline and immediacy of feedback and response.
